Upper Hand (Japanese: はやてがえし Quick Hand Reversal) is a damage-dealing Fighting-type move introduced in Generation IX.

Effect

If the target is about to use a move with increased priority, Upper Hand will strike first and cause the target to flinch. Upper Hand will fail if the target isn't about to use an increased priority move.
